3964(r)

aleXandroW

Level-2
Beiträge
59
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o,

ich habe ein Problem mit einer Schnittstelle. Baue zur Zeit eine Blasfolienextruder auf S7 um. Dabei wird die Dicke de Folie gemessen und geregelt.
Die Komunikation läuft über "Siemens 3964R protocol over Current Loop (2400 Baud)". Die Funktion und das Telegramm wird vom Hersteller nicht verraten. Laut Schaltplan sieht es nach RS422 aus.
Habe mit der 1SI Baugruppe von Siemens versucht die Schnitttelle abzuhören. Rx hat immer geblinkt aber keine Daten emfangen.Beispielprogramm zum senden und empfangen von Siemens benutzt.
Als nächstes mit einem alten PG740 und Snoopy Schnittstellenanalysator versucht.Aber auch keine brauchbaren Informationen erhalten.

Jemand Erfahrung oder ein Denkanstoss?

Anbei ein wenig Infos zum Protokoll
 

Anhänge

  • OK328.jpg
    OK328.jpg
    185,2 KB · Aufrufe: 40
Current Loop hört sich nach TTY an, also der "normalen" S5-Schnittstelle.

3964R wird von CP340/341 unterstützt, gibts jeweils auch in einer 20mA (TTY) Schnittstelle.

Mfg
Manuel
 
3964R ist auch der Rahmen, in den die Nutzdaten dann verpackt werden. Dieser Rahmen wird von der empfangenden CP entfernt und nur die Nutzdaten werden weitergegeben. Wie dort was zu behandeln ist, muss aus dem S5-Programm hergeleitet werden, wenn der Hersteller die Kooperation verweigert bzw. keine Doku dazu vorhanden ist.
Ansonsten CP340/341 mit TTY verwenden wie MSB bereits geschrieben hat.
 
Evtl. hast du noch einen Pegelwandler der RS232 nach TTY wandelt. Das könnte dann mit etwas Glück deine 1SI 3964/ASCII Baugruppe für ET200S zum kommunizieren bringen.
 
Zurück
Oben